Ministers of the Aughwick/Germany Valley Church of the Brethren

1802 - Christian Long

1804 - Jacob Lutz

1806 - John Hanawalt

1826 - Peter Long

1827 - Andrew Spanogle

1827 - John King

1830 - Andrew Spanogle Jr.

1835 - Michael Bollinger

1839 - Graybil Myers

1839 - Christian Long Jr.

1842 - John G G***k

1844 - John Spanogle

1847 - Abraham L Funk

1850 - Enoch Eby

1855 - George Myers Sr.

1858 - James R Lane

1860 - Peter L Swayne

1861 - Christian Myers

1869 - Issac Book

1874 - Seth W Myers

1877 - William L Spanogle

1879 - John B Shope

1882 - John E Garver

1892 - Walter S Long

1894 - Herman B Landis

1895 - Bruce J Myers

1898 - George H Swayne

1898 - Milton H Wright

1902 - Samuel A Norris

1902 - Roy X Wilson

1902 - William F Spindle

1905 - Jesse C Rupert

1910 - David L Little

1921 - Dewitt H Miller

1923 - Alexander M Stout

1927 - William Hanawalt

1937 - Jacob Dick

1938 - Martin & Marian Scholton

1947 - Myrl Weyant

1953 - David Emerson

1953 - Fern Dunmire

1953 - Robert Sooby

1957 - Albert M Haught

1967 - Raymond Risden

1969 - Howard Ogburn

1970 - John Keiper

1975 - Roy Myers

1977 - Harold Knepp

1982 - Raymond Hill

2001 - Ernest Dell

2012 - Timothy Miller
